Royal Decree 50/87 Appointing an Undersecretary for Media Affairs and Promoting a Director General

Arabic

We, Qaboos bin Said, the Sultan of Oman

after perusal of Royal Decree 26/75 Issuing the Law Governing the Administrative Apparatus of the State and its amendments,

and Royal Decree 8/80 Issuing the Civil Service Law and its amendments,

and in pursuance of public interest,

have decreed as follows

Article 1

Hamad bin Mohammed bin Mohsen Al-Rashdi is hereby appointed Undersecretary for Media Affairs.

Article 2

Ahmed bin Salim bin Mubarak Al-Rawas is hereby transferred to the first financial grade of the first circle of the general schedule designated for an undersecretary of a ministry.

Article 3

This decree must be published in the Official Gazette, and comes into force from the date of its issuance.

Issued on: 24 Shawwal 1407
Corresponding to: 20 June 1987

Qaboos bin Said
Sultan of Oman

Published in Official Gazette 362 issued on 1 July 1987.

Royal Decree 49/87 Approving the Petroleum Agreement Signed on 4 May 1987 with International Petroleum Corporation

Arabic

We, Qaboos bin Said, the Sultan of Oman

after perusal of Royal Decree 26/75 Issuing the Law Governing the Administrative Apparatus of the State and its amendments,

Royal Decree 42/74 Issuing the Oil and Minerals Law,

and the Petroleum Agreement Between the Government of the Sultanate of Oman and International Petroleum Corporation, signed on 4 May 1987 Between the Minister of Oil and Minerals, representing the Government of the Sultanate, and the mentioned company,

and in pursuance of public interest,

have decreed as follows

Article 1

The mentioned petroleum agreement signed on 4 May 1987 Between the Government of the Sultanate of Oman and International Petroleum Corporation is hereby approved.

Article 2

This decree must be published in the Official Gazette, and comes into force from the date of its issuance.

Issued on: 22 Shawwal 1407
Corresponding to: 18 June 1987

Qaboos bin Said
Sultan of Oman

Published in Official Gazette 362 issued on 1 July 1987.

Royal Decree 48/87 Appointing Members in the Board of Directors of Oman Chamber of Commerce and Industry

Arabic

We, Qaboos bin Said, the Sultan of Oman

after perusal of Royal Decree 26/75 Issuing the Law Governing the Administrative Apparatus of the State and its amendments,

and the General Statute of the Chamber of Commerce and Industry in the Sultanate of Oman issued on 15 May 1973 and its amendments,

and in pursuance of public interest,

have decreed as follows

Article 1

The following are hereby appointed members of the Board of Directors of the Oman Chamber of Commerce and Industry for a term of four years:

1. Ahmed bin Salim bin Said Al-Marhoon.

2. Said bin Salim bin Abdullah Al-Amri.

3. Mohammed bin Ali bin Mohammed Al-Balushi.

4. Sulaiman bin Saif bin Obaid Al-Azzani.

5. Mohammed bin Abdullah bin Mohammed Al-Maskari.

6. Said bin Amer bin Saif Al-Bahri.

7. Abdullah bin Darwish bin Mohammed Al-Shihi.

Article 2

All that is contrary to this decree is hereby repealed.

Article 3

This decree must be published in the Official Gazette, and comes into force from the date of its issuance.

Issued on: 22 Shawwal 1407
Corresponding to: 18 June 1987

Qaboos bin Said
Sultan of Oman

Published in Official Gazette 362 issued on 1 July 1987.

Royal Decree 46/87 Amending Income Tax on Mixed Companies in Which Omani Citizens Own a Share in Their Capital

Arabic

We, Qaboos bin Said, the Sultan of Oman

after perusal of Royal Decree 26/75 Issuing the Law Governing the Administrative Apparatus of the State and its amendments,

Royal Decree 65/77 Reducing Income Tax on Mixed Companies,

and Royal Decree 47/81 Issuing the Corporate Income Tax Law,

and in pursuance of public interest,

have decreed as follows

Article 1

With effect from the tax year whose balance sheet is closed on a date subsequent to the entry into force of this decree, income tax on mixed companies in which Omani citizens own a share in their capital is hereby determined in accordance with the following percentages and conditions:

1. Companies in which Omani citizens own more than 50% of the paid-up capital:

(a) The first thirty thousand Rial of net profit is exempt from tax.

(b) The next one hundred and seventy thousand Rial of net profit: 20%.

(c) Any excess of net profit: 25%.

2. Companies in which Omani citizens own between 35% and 50% of the paid-up capital:

(a) The first thirty thousand Rial of net profit is exempt from tax.

(b) The next one hundred and seventy thousand Rial of net profit: 25%.

(c) Any excess of net profit: 30%.

3. For companies in which Omani citizens own less than 35% of the paid-up capital, the rates provided in the Second Schedule attached to the mentioned Royal Decree 47/81 apply.

4. The provisions of the mentioned Royal Decree 65/77 and Royal Decree 47/81 continue to apply to mixed companies operating in the fields of agriculture, fisheries, industry, and mining.

Article 2

This decree must be published in the Official Gazette.

Issued on: 20 Shawwal 1407
Corresponding to: 16 June 1987

Qaboos bin Said
Sultan of Oman

Published in Official Gazette 362 issued on 1 July 1987.

Royal Decree 45/87 Appointing a Deputy President of the Commercial Dispute Resolution Tribunal

Arabic

We, Qaboos bin Said, the Sultan of Oman

after perusal of Royal Decree 26/75 Issuing the Law Governing the Administrative Apparatus of the State and its amendments,

Royal Decree 8/80 Issuing the Civil Service Law and its amendments,

and Royal Decree 38/87 Amending the Formation of the Commercial Dispute Resolution Tribunal and the Statute for Examining Claims and Requests for Arbitration Made Before It,

and in pursuance of public interest,

have decreed as follows

Article 1

Hamad bin Mohammed bin Hamdan Al-Sharji is hereby appointed Deputy President of the Commercial Dispute Resolution Tribunal.

Article 2

This decree must be published in the Official Gazette, and comes into force from the date of its publication.

Issued on: 20 Shawwal 1407
Corresponding to: 16 June 1987

Qaboos bin Said
Sultan of Oman

Published in Official Gazette 362 issued on 1 July 1987.
